Please Support OCSS Through Patreon! / oceancapablesmallsailboat Members watch 1 day early! -- CONTENTS OF THIS VIDEO -- 0:00 - Intro 0:46 - Buoyancy Arch Purpose 1:21 - The Plan 1:55 - CAD Model Detail Views 2:35 - Cutting out G-10 for Padeyes 5:54 - Attachment of Padeyes Discussion 6:37 - Drilling and Routing out Foam 7:56 - Epoxying on the Padeyes 8:45 - Carbon Fibering the Padeyes and Ends of the Wing 10:10 - Trimming off Excess Carbon Fiber 11:16 - Outro THE BOAT: Scow Bow Mini-Cruiser. 14’ long (4.25M,) with a 6’ beam (1.8M,) and a draft of 2’6” (0.77M.) Based on an estimate using the CAD model, she will displace 34.8 ft3 of seawater, which weighs 2,225lbs. She features a self-righting design, twin keels, and a Ljungström rig. Built using the foam sandwich construction method. Every design decision is made to keep her simple, strong, and watertight. In this episode I continue work on the buoyancy arch. This will make my boat self-righting in all conditions. I build the G-10 padeyes for the mainsheet to attach to on the horizontal wing of the arch. I attach those and then secure them on to the ends of the wing with 4 layers of 6oz carbon fiber.
